Understanding Paint Correction: A Key to Restoring Your Car’s Shine

0
109

Maintaining the perfect finish of your car is a challenge that every vehicle owner faces. Over time, your car's paint can develop imperfections such as swirl marks, scratches, oxidation, and water spots. Enter paint correction—a professional process designed to restore and enhance your car’s exterior, giving it a flawless, mirror-like shine.

What is Paint Correction?

Paint correction is a detailed process that involves removing imperfections in the car’s clear coat using specialized tools and products. The process typically includes machine polishing with compounds to smooth out the damaged layers of paint. Unlike simple waxing or washing, paint correction addresses deeper flaws in the paint surface, often requiring a multi-step approach depending on the severity of the damage.

The Benefits of Paint Correction

Investing in paint correction offers numerous advantages:

  1. Enhanced Aesthetics: Paint correction restores the car’s finish to its original showroom shine, making it look as good as new.
  2. Increased Resale Value: A well-maintained exterior can significantly improve your car's market value.
  3. Protection from Further Damage: Post-paint correction, applying a ceramic coating or sealant can protect the corrected paint from UV rays, dirt, and other environmental factors.

Steps in the Paint Correction Process

  1. Inspection and Preparation: The process begins with washing and decontaminating the car to remove dirt and debris.
  2. Evaluating the Paint Condition: Technicians identify the imperfections that need correction.
  3. Polishing and Buffing: Using a polishing machine and compounds, layers of imperfections are carefully removed. This step often takes the most time and skill.
  4. Final Touches: Once the desired finish is achieved, a protective coating is applied to preserve the newly corrected paint.

Is Paint Correction Worth It?

If you’re passionate about maintaining the appearance of your car, paint correction is undoubtedly worth the investment. Whether your car has minor swirl marks or significant paint defects, this process can rejuvenate its look and extend the life of its finish. While it requires professional expertise, the long-term results make it a popular choice for car enthusiasts and regular owners alike.
